Wat Niwet Thamprawat
Wat Niwet Thamprawat

Phra Nakhon Si Ayutthaya

Operating day:

Daily

Operating time: 08.00 - 18.00

Contact Details

Category : Temple

Attraction Details :

This temple, which was built Rama V (Chulalongkorn), looks more like a Gothic Christian church than a Thai temple. Visitors can access the temple by crossing the river in a small trolley-like cable car. The crossing is free of charge. There are several nice boat trips departing from Bangkok to Bang Pa-In Palace, especially through cruise tours. The Palace is open from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. daily with an admission fee of 50 bahts.
